Feel free to recommend me vs Fell free to recommend me

The correct phrase is 'feel free to recommend me.' 'Fell' is a past tense verb, while 'feel' is the correct present tense verb in this context. 'Feel free to recommend me' is a common and correct phrase used to encourage someone to make a recommendation.
